Carvalho’s Late Strike Earns Draw For Brentford Against Chelsea

Brentford substitute Fabio Carvalho’s 93th-minute equaliser denied Chelsea victory in a dramatic London derby on Saturday.

The 23 years old had been on the pitch for less than four minutes before turning in from a long Kevin Schade throw-in.

With the visitors a goal down, Cole Palmer swept in a first-time volley to equalise just after the hour mark, having only been on for five minutes.

Then Garnacho, recently signed from Manchester United, helped set up midfielder Moises Caicedo to power in a shot past Brentford goalkeeper Caoimhin Kelleher in the 85th minute.

Brentford had deserved their half-time lead – forward Schade struck in the 35th minute shot after Jordan Henderson’s long ball had sparked a counter-attack.

Chelsea head coach Enzo Maresca dipped into his vast playing resources by making three half-time changes in response.

Reece James, Marc Cucurella and Tyrique George came on for debutant Facundo Buonanotte, a deadline-day loan signing from Brighton, Jorrel Hato, another new arrival, and Wesley Fofana, making his first start since recovering from a major hamstring injury.
